yes,

It's the BCM that's different between low/mid/high spec cars.

Of course the ECU controls engine and trans (for auto I6s), so make sure the ECU you get is from a similar engine/trans car.

Ford brought out different ECUs for different wheel size, diff ratio, etc as well.

You would be surprised how many different variations there is, just get a factory workshop manual and check out some of the listings.

They are different Peter... Dont forget you would loose your speed sensitive steering if you went to anything other than a Ghia V8 ECU.

They are a special one off ECU. Same as the I6 Ghia ECU.
